ORDER

1/5

The writ petitioner seeks for issuance of Writ of Certiorari to quash the impugned notice of demand dated 12.04.2024 pursuant to the Order of cancellation of registration issued by the respondent.

2. The grievance of the petitioner is that he was never served with the notice of assessment at the place where he is running business, whereas the impugned notice was served at his residential address. If the petitioner was served notice to the address where he is running business, then the petitioner would have been better placed to give his representation or to address the concerns and requirements of the Department.

3. The learned counsel for the respondent would submit that notice has been duly sent to the place of business and residence.

4. Heard Mr.R.Kumar, learned counsel appearing for the petitioner and Mrs.K.Vasanthamala, Government Advocate for the respondent. 2/5

5. Without going to the merits of the case, I feel that a reasonable opportunity has to be given to the writ petitioner. However, at the same, the writ petitioner has to be put on terms, in order to equally safeguardthe interest of the Department.

6. Accordingly, this Writ Petition is disposed of on the following terms :

[i] The impugned notice dated 12.04.2024 of the respondent is quashed.

[ii] As a pre condition, the petitioner shall pay 10% of the tax within a period of six we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this Order.

[iii] The Department shall serve fresh notice on the petitioner within a period of two weeks and thereafter, call for objection and after affording personal hearing and due enquiry, fresh Orders shall be passed in accordance with law and on merits within a period of eight weeks thereafter.

No costs.
